Wireframe Model Uses. Web a wireframe is a simple diagram that represents the skeleton of a website or an application’s user interface (ui) and core. Web wireframes are used by ux designers and web designers to provide a clear visual understanding of page. Web product managers and business analysts use wireframes to translate requirements into visual specifications for designers or developers. Web wireframing is a process where designers draw overviews of interactive products to establish the structure and flow of possible design solutions. Web wireframes are basic blueprints that help teams align on requirements, keeping ux design conversations focused and constructive.
